AI Summary

  • Prohibits artificial intelligence, algorithms, or other software tools from denying, delaying, or modifying health care services during utilization review

  • Requires AI-based utilization review tools to base determinations on individual enrollee medical history and clinical circumstances, not solely on group datasets

  • Mandates that AI tools cannot replace the role of health care providers in the determination process and must not result in unfair discrimination against enrollees

  • Requires carriers to report quarterly whether AI tools were used in making adverse decisions, and to review AI performance and outcomes at least quarterly for accuracy and reliability

  • Applies to insurers, HMOs, dental plan organizations, pharmacy benefits managers, and private review agents conducting utilization review in Maryland, effective October 1, 2025

Legislative Description

Health Insurance - Utilization Review - Use of Artificial Intelligence
